What the Constitution says
As I wrote earlier this week, the Republican bill violates the North Carolina Constitution on its face. Even Bob Orr, constitutional scholar that he is, has to agree on that point.
Sec. 5. Allegiance to the United States.
Every citizen of this State owes paramount allegiance to the Constitution and government of the United States, and no law or ordinance of the State in contravention or subversion thereof can have any binding force.
